In-portal 5.0.3 Remote Arbitrary File Upload Exploit

In-portal 5.0.3 is vulnerable to a remote arbitrary file upload vulnerability. This vulnerability exists due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input in the 'FileUpload' function of the 'commands.php' script. An attacker can exploit this vulnerability to upload arbitrary files to the web server, which can lead to remote code execution. The vulnerable code is located in the 'path/core/editor/editor/filemanager/connectors/php/config.php' and 'path/core/editor/editor/filemanager/connectors/php/commands.php' scripts.
